#720c4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#720c4f is composed of 44.7% red, 4.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.5% magenta, 30.7%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 320.6 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 24.7%. #720c4f color hex could be obtained by blending #e4189e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#720c4f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080105 is the darkest color, while #fef5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#720c4f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#423c40 is the less saturated color, while #7c0252 is the most saturated one.
